Transaction 34c585aab19b96c1b4824c435690b3efe87760900a5934acb89e89e3e04a986c
1 Input
1 Output
-
34c585aab19b96c1b4824c435690b3efe87760900a5934acb89e89e3e04a986c:0
- value
- 19970000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8f820fb62601412a5ed38b7bedbc7b17b468ed58 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1E5oSFkjdCpWz3haaikgx88XLnVQYYPAFx